ABB 2CPX062502R9999 Interior fitting system - HDG
Part Number: 2CPX062502R9999
Quick Summary
Interior fitting system 2CPX062502R9999 from ABB enables secure, adjustable mounting on 25x25 mm profile rails. This design addresses misalignment and time wasted on rework during panel assembly. Certified with CE conformity, RoHS compliance, and REACH declarations, it meets European safety and material standards. In practice, it enhances installation efficiency, minimizes part variation, and supports scalable automation projects. The unit is built from steel with hot dip galvanizing for corrosion resistance in demanding workshop environments. Dimensions are 25 x 25 x 10 mm, designed to fit profile rails listed as No. 3 (32 x 25 mm) and support M12 connections.

Extended Description
2CPX062502R9999 ABB: Slide nuts for profile rails, L x W x D in mm: 25 x 25 x 10, M12, suitable for aluminum profile rails, profile No. 3 (32 x 25 mm).

Slide nuts for 25x25 mm profile rails provide a secure, clamped connection that remains aligned under vibration and dynamic loads commonly seen in plant floors and packaging lines. This reduces rework, speeds up assembly, and yields more predictable panel layouts. In panel building and automation projects, engineers can position components precisely, retain settings through maintenance intervals, and achieve repeatable results across multiple lines. Crafted from steel with hot-dip galvanizing, the parts resist corrosion and wear in demanding environments such as washdown zones and high-humidity manufacturing areas. The protective finish lowers maintenance costs, extends service life, and supports longer intervals between torque checks and replacements. Typical applications include machine frames, workstations, line-mounted enclosures, and mounting points for sensors and actuators in automotive, packaging, and food-and-beverage sectors. Dimensions are 25 x 25 x 10 mm with M12 threading, designed to fit aluminum profile rails and profile No. 3 (32 x 25 mm).
